About

Edward Jefferson Hitchcock is an estate planning attorney with more than 36 years of legal experience, practicing at Hitchcock Law Firm, PLLC in Saint Paul, MN. He earned a B.A. from Hamline University in 1986 and a J.D. from William Mitchell College of Law in 1990. He has been admitted to the Minnesota Bar since 1990. His practice encompasses estate planning, entertainment, business, and real estate, allowing him to serve clients across a range of legal needs. He maintains a clean professional disciplinary record.
